What You’ll Do:

  • Provide comprehensive emergency nursing care—assessment, triage, intervention, and evaluation.
  • Administer medications and treatments safely and accurately.
  • Collaborate with physicians and multidisciplinary teams to develop and implement patient care plans.
  • Respond swiftly and effectively to critical situations and codes.
  • Educate patients and families on care, treatment, and discharge instructions.
  • Ensure accurate, timely documentation in compliance with Well Star standards.

What You’ll Bring:

Experience:

  • Minimum 2+ years of recent, direct ED RN experience required.

Education:

  • Graduate of an accredited nursing program (BSN preferred) required.

Required Licensure/Certifications:

  • Active RN license (Georgia or Compact) required.
  • BLS – Basic Life Support required.
  • ACLS – Advanced Cardiovascular Life Support required.
  • PALS – Pediatric Advanced Life Support required.
  • TNCC- Trauma Nurse Core Course or ATCN - Adv Trauma Care for Nurses Cert preferred.

Skills:

  • Critical thinking, adaptability, teamwork, and the ability to thrive under pressure.
